James Winston Stokes

James Winston Stokes
June 28, 1937 – July 30, 2021

James Winston Stokes age 84 of Thomaston, AL died July 30, 2021 at his home. He was born June 28, 1937 in Thomaston, AL to William Everette and Bertha Grey Stokes. He was retired from the Marengo County Board of Education and a retired as sergeant with the Alabama National Guard in 1993. He was a member of Sardis Baptist Church and a member of St. Alban’s Masonic Lodge #22 F & FM.

He is survived by his wife, Catherine B. Stokes of Thomaston, AL; two sons, James Wayne Stokes and John Douglas Stokes of Thomaston, AL; two brothers, Elvin Myles Stokes and Billy Gaines Stokes of Thomaston, AL; sister, Phyllis Hicks Jackson of Pine Hill, AL; four grandchildren, Kylie Elizabeth Stokes, Tebow Cullen Stokes, Molly Kate Stokes, and Anna Kate Golden.

He was preceded in death by his parents, William Everette Stokes and Bertha Grey Stokes; brothers, Charles Everette Stokes, Warren Lyman Stokes, and Willie Argle Stokes; sisters, Alice Lalene McGilberry and Anniece Joyce Clark.

Funeral services were held at O’Bryant Chapel Funeral Home in Thomasville, AL on Tuesday, August 3, 2021 at 11:00 am with Rev. Mike Snow officiating. Burial followed at Thomaston Cemetery.

Active pallbearers were Joe Hicks, Jr., Steve Stokes, Richard Stokes, David Stokes, Chris Clark, and Scotty Stokes.

Honorary pallbearers were Jason Stokes, Gabe Myrick, Paul Stokes, Brian Stokes, Ronnie Stokes, and Darrell Stokes.
